Becoming a trusted authority in your industry isn't easy. It's a journey that requires consistent effort and the right actions. But because everyone's goals, resources, and backgrounds are unique, there's no one-size-fits-all approach to personal branding. The coaching industry adds another layer of complexity because it lacks regulation. Different strategists may focus on different things based on their background and expertise. However, there are essential elements that are crucial for effective personal branding, and focusing on the shiny marketing assets usually comes in way too early. Your personal brand is your reputation. To succeed in personal branding, you need to understand how you see yourself, how others see you, and where you want to go. This self-awareness is key to building a solid strategy. That's why I specialise in personal branding. With my clients, we don't just wait for the future to happen but we actively dessign and shape it. Whether it's building on strengths or forging a new path, strategic personal branding is about creating a future that matches your goals and dreams.
